Ingredients
For the Meatloaf:
-
1/2 pound (225g) ground beef (80/20 or 85/15 for best flavor)
-
1 small onion, finely chopped
-
1 clove garlic, minced
-
1 tablespoon butter
-
1/4 teaspoon dried thyme
-
1/2 teaspoon salt
-
1/4 teaspoon ground black pepper
-
1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
-
1 large egg
-
3 tablespoons breadcrumbs
-
Alternative: 3 tbsp almond flour or 4 tbsp old-fashioned oats
-
For the Glaze:
-
1/4 cup (60ml) ketchup
-
1 tablespoon molasses
️ Equipment
-
Small slow cooker (1.5 to 3-quart size)
-
Aluminum foil (for easy removal and cleanup)
-
Non-stick spray
-
Mixing bowl
-
Small skillet
Instructions
Step 1: Prepare the Slow Cooker
-
Cut a 12-inch piece of aluminum foil in half lengthwise.
-
Fold each strip lengthwise again to create two long, sturdy strips.
-
Cross the strips in the bottom of your slow cooker to create a “sling.”
-
Trim the foil so it doesn’t extend beyond the top edge.
-
-
Spray both the foil and the interior of the slow cooker bowl with non-stick cooking spray.
Why foil? It acts as a sling to lift the meatloaf out easily, keeping excess grease in the pot and preserving the shape of the loaf.
Step 2: Cook Aromatics
-
In a small skillet, melt 1 tbsp of butter over medium heat.
-
Add chopped onion and garlic, cooking until soft and fragrant (about 3–4 minutes).
-
Stir in dried thyme, salt, and pepper. Cook 1 minute more.
-
Remove from heat and allow to cool slightly.
Pro Tip: Sautéing onions and garlic in butter not only mellows their sharpness but adds richness and moisture to the meatloaf.
Step 3: Mix the Meatloaf
-
In a large bowl, combine:
-
Ground beef
-
Sautéed onion and garlic
-
Worcestershire sauce
-
Egg
-
Breadcrumbs (or oat/almond flour alternative)
-
-
Gently mix by hand or with a spoon until just combined.
-
Do not overmix, which can make the meatloaf tough.
-
-
Shape into a rounded or oval loaf (about 5 inches long).
Step 4: Slow Cook
-
Gently transfer the meatloaf to the center of the foil sling in your slow cooker.
-
Cover and cook on LOW for 6 hours.
Step 5: Add the Glaze
-
In a small bowl, mix:
-
1/4 cup ketchup
-
1 tbsp molasses
-
-
At the 5½-hour mark, spread the glaze over the top of the meatloaf.
-
Re-cover and cook for the final 30 minutes.
✨ The glaze becomes beautifully sticky and caramelized in the last half hour.
Step 6: Serve and Store
-
Use the foil sling to lift the meatloaf out.
-
Let it rest 5–10 minutes before slicing for cleaner cuts.
-
Serve with mashed potatoes, green beans, or roasted veggies.
️ Serving Suggestions
-
Classic combo: Buttery mashed potatoes and steamed peas or green beans
-
Low-carb option: Cauliflower mash or a crisp green salad
-
Leftover idea: Slice and reheat in a skillet or air fryer, then tuck into a sandwich
Storage Tips
-
Fridge: Store leftovers in an airtight container up to 3 days.
-
Freezer: Wrap slices tightly and freeze up to 2 months. Thaw overnight before reheating.
Variations & Tips
-
Add-ins: Try finely chopped bell peppers, parsley, or a teaspoon of Dijon mustard.
-
Protein switch: Use ground turkey or chicken, but reduce breadcrumbs slightly for moisture.
-
Gluten-free: Use almond flour or certified gluten-free oats.
